2010年8月15日

yum-security-check

yum install yum-changelog
wget http://yum-security-check.googlecode.com/files/yum-security-check-v0.1.pl


change line 9
#use Expect::Simple;

line 33
        #my $eobj = new Expect::Simple {
        #       Cmd => "/usr/bin/yum --changelog update $_",
        #       Prompt => [ -re => 'Is this ok.*'],
        #       DisconnectCmd => 'n',
        #       Verbose => 0,
        #       Timeout => 300,
        #};
to
my $str = `echo n | /usr/bin/yum --changelog update "$_"`;

line 45
                #print "\n--------\n$_\n----------\n";
                #$security_info .= "\n=========$_==============\n$_\n";